Best Hiking Pants for Different Weather Conditions

When it comes to hiking, the right gear can make all the difference, and one of the most crucial pieces of equipment is a good pair of hiking pants. The best hiking pants are designed to provide comfort, durability, and protection against the elements, but the ideal choice can vary significantly depending on the weather conditions you expect to encounter. Therefore, understanding the different types of hiking pants available for various climates is essential for any outdoor enthusiast.

In warm weather, lightweight and breathable hiking pants are essential. These pants are typically made from moisture-wicking fabrics that help keep you cool and dry as you trek through the heat. Look for options with features like zip-off legs, which allow you to convert pants into shorts, providing versatility as temperatures fluctuate throughout the day. Additionally, pants with UPF protection can shield your skin from harmful UV rays, making them a smart choice for sunny hikes. Many brands also incorporate ventilation panels or mesh lining to enhance airflow, ensuring that you remain comfortable even during strenuous activities.

As the weather turns cooler, the need for insulation becomes paramount. In these conditions, hiking pants made from thicker materials, such as fleece-lined or softshell fabrics, can provide the warmth you need without sacrificing mobility. Softshell pants are particularly advantageous because they offer a balance of breathability and water resistance, making them suitable for chilly, damp environments. When selecting pants for colder weather, consider those with adjustable waistbands and cuffs, which can help trap heat and keep cold air out. Layering is also an effective strategy; wearing thermal leggings underneath your hiking pants can provide an extra layer of warmth without adding bulk.

When rain is in the forecast, waterproof or water-resistant hiking pants become indispensable. These pants are typically made from materials like Gore-Tex or other proprietary fabrics that repel water while allowing moisture from sweat to escape. Look for features such as sealed seams and adjustable cuffs to enhance their effectiveness in keeping you dry. Additionally, many waterproof pants are designed to be lightweight and packable, making them easy to carry in your backpack for unexpected weather changes. It’s also worth considering pants with a breathable membrane, as this will help regulate your body temperature during intense hikes, preventing you from overheating.

In snowy conditions, insulated and waterproof pants are essential for maintaining warmth and dryness. Snow-specific hiking pants often come with additional features such as reinforced knees and seat areas to withstand the rigors of winter hiking. Look for options with gaiters or snow cuffs that prevent snow from entering your boots, ensuring that your feet stay dry and warm. Furthermore, pants with adjustable waistbands and suspenders can provide a secure fit, allowing for freedom of movement while navigating through deep snow.

Key Features to Look for in Hiking Trousers

When it comes to selecting the perfect hiking trousers, several key features can significantly enhance your outdoor experience. First and foremost, the material of the trousers plays a crucial role in determining comfort and functionality. Look for fabrics that are lightweight yet durable, as they will withstand the rigors of the trail while providing breathability. Materials such as nylon or polyester blends are often favored for their quick-drying properties, which can be particularly beneficial if you encounter unexpected rain or stream crossings.

In addition to material, the fit of the trousers is essential for mobility and comfort. Opt for a design that allows for a full range of motion, especially in the knees and hips. Many hiking trousers come with articulated knees or a relaxed fit, which can make a significant difference during long treks. Furthermore, consider the length of the trousers; some hikers prefer full-length pants for added protection against brush and insects, while others may opt for convertible styles that can be zipped off into shorts, providing versatility for varying weather conditions.

Another important feature to consider is the presence of pockets. Functional pockets can be invaluable for storing essentials like maps, snacks, or a small first-aid kit. Look for trousers with secure, zippered pockets to ensure that your belongings stay safe while you navigate rugged terrain. Additionally, some hiking trousers come equipped with specialized pockets designed for items like smartphones or multi-tools, which can enhance convenience on the trail.

Moreover, consider the weather resistance of the trousers. If you plan to hike in areas prone to rain or wet conditions, investing in water-resistant or waterproof trousers can be a wise choice. Many brands offer trousers with a durable water repellent (DWR) finish, which helps to repel moisture while still allowing for breathability. This feature can keep you dry and comfortable, even during unexpected downpours.

Ventilation is another key aspect to keep in mind. Hiking can be physically demanding, and as your body temperature rises, having trousers with ventilation options can help regulate your comfort. Look for features such as mesh-lined pockets or zippered vents that allow for airflow, especially in warmer climates. This added breathability can make a significant difference in your overall comfort level during long hikes.

Additionally, consider the weight of the trousers. Lightweight options are often preferred by backpackers who need to minimize their load. However, it’s essential to strike a balance between weight and durability; you want trousers that can withstand the elements without sacrificing comfort. Many modern hiking trousers are designed to be both lightweight and robust, making them an excellent choice for various hiking conditions.

Top Brands for Durable Hiking Pants

When it comes to selecting the perfect hiking pants, durability is a key factor that every outdoor enthusiast should consider. The right pair of hiking trousers can make a significant difference in comfort and performance on the trails. With numerous brands on the market, it can be overwhelming to choose the best option. However, several top brands have established themselves as leaders in producing high-quality, durable hiking pants that cater to various needs and preferences.

One of the most recognized names in outdoor apparel is Patagonia. Known for its commitment to sustainability and environmental responsibility, Patagonia offers a range of hiking pants designed to withstand the rigors of outdoor adventures. Their products often feature durable materials that resist wear and tear while providing comfort and flexibility. Additionally, Patagonia’s focus on ethical manufacturing practices appeals to environmentally conscious consumers, making their hiking trousers a popular choice among eco-friendly hikers.

Another brand that stands out in the realm of hiking pants is The North Face. With a reputation for innovation and performance, The North Face designs trousers that are not only durable but also equipped with advanced technologies. Many of their hiking pants incorporate moisture-wicking fabrics and breathable materials, ensuring that wearers remain comfortable during strenuous activities. Furthermore, The North Face offers a variety of styles, from lightweight options for warm weather to insulated pants for colder conditions, making it easy for hikers to find the perfect fit for their specific needs.

Columbia is also a prominent player in the hiking apparel market, known for its affordability without compromising on quality. Their hiking pants often feature Omni-Shade technology, which provides UV protection, and Omni-Tech, which offers waterproof and breathable capabilities. This combination makes Columbia trousers an excellent choice for hikers who may encounter varying weather conditions. Additionally, the brand’s focus on functionality, such as pockets for storage and adjustable waistbands, enhances the overall hiking experience.

For those seeking a more technical approach, Arc’teryx is a brand that should not be overlooked. Renowned for its high-performance outdoor gear, Arc’teryx hiking pants are designed with the serious adventurer in mind. The brand utilizes advanced materials and construction techniques to create trousers that are lightweight yet incredibly durable. Their attention to detail ensures that every seam and stitch is optimized for performance, making them a favorite among mountaineers and backcountry enthusiasts.

Furthermore, REI Co-op offers a range of hiking pants that balance quality and value. As a retailer with a strong commitment to the outdoor community, REI Co-op designs its products with input from avid hikers. Their hiking trousers often feature practical elements such as zip-off legs for versatility and reinforced knees for added durability. This thoughtful design approach ensures that hikers can enjoy their outdoor pursuits without worrying about the longevity of their gear.
